Bible Translation Options

Choosing the right Bible translation for your Schuyler Wide Margin Bible can greatly enhance your reading and study experience. Bible translations differ in language style, accuracy, and readability. For instance, if you’re a beginner or casual reader, the New Living Translation (NLT) offers contemporary language that’s easy to grasp. If you prefer a balance between readability and fidelity to original texts, the English Standard Version (ESV) might be your best bet. On the other hand, the New American Standard Bible (NASB) excels in accuracy, making it ideal for in-depth study. Consider how you’ll use your Bible—whether for devotional reading, study, or teaching—because different translations serve specific purposes better than others.

Binding Quality Assessment

When selecting a Schuyler Wide Margin Bible, the quality of the binding is a key factor that can greatly enhance your reading experience. Schuyler Bibles feature smyth-sewn binding, which not only boosts durability but also allows the Bible to lay flat when open—perfect for note-taking. The high-quality leather cover adds a luxurious feel and guarantees longevity, outlasting synthetic alternatives. This binding is crafted to withstand frequent use, minimizing the risk of pages loosening or covers wearing out. Many users appreciate how sturdy binding and quality craftsmanship result in a Bible that endures years of study. Additionally, proper binding techniques help prevent page misalignment, making the text consistently accessible throughout the Bible’s lifespan.
